OpenClaw gateway agents.files symlink escape allowed out-of-workspace file read/write
Impact The gateway agents.files.get and agents.files.set methods allowed symlink traversal for allowlisted workspace files. A symlinked allowlisted file for example AGENTS.md could resolve outside the agent workspace and be read/written by the gateway process. This could enable arbitrary host fil...

LLMs Generate Predictable Passwords
LLMs are bad at generating passwords: There are strong noticeable patterns among these 50 passwords that can be seen easily: All of the passwords start with a letter, usually uppercase G, almost always followed by the digit 7. Character choices are highly uneven for example, L , 9, m, 2, $ and...
